1 of the American Legion is a vacant lot in Van Tassell, Wyoming where one of the first American Legion posts in the United States was established in 1919.
The post was named after Ferdinand Branstetter, a Van Tassell resident who died in World War I.
The site was listed on the National Register of Historic Places in 1969.
[1] In 1969, it was hoped that an interpretative sign would be put up, and also possibly that a restored post building would be constructed.
